#96d4c4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#96d4c4 is composed of 58.8% red, 83.1%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 7.5%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 164.5 degrees, a saturation of 41.9% and a lightness of 71%. #96d4c4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#2da989.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

● #96d4c4 color description : Slightly desaturated cyan - lime green.
#96d4c4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#96d4c4 has RGB values of R:150, G:212, B:196 and CMYK values of C:0.29, M:0, Y:0.08,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 9884868.

Shades and Tints of #96d4c4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030605 is the darkest color, while #f7fcf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#96d4c4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b2b8b6 is the less saturated color, while #6efcd7 is the most saturated one.
